Miss Earlham Candidates Now Selling Raffle Tickets

School is out and the 4th of July is just around the corner, which means it is time for Miss Earlham. This year, on the 30th anniversary of the Miss Earlham contest, there are 15 young ladies who will be out and about selling raffle tickets. Contestants have just completed seventh grade and will be knocking at your door selling tickets for $1 per ticket. Tickets will be available for purchase up until the afternoon of the 4th. The winner of Miss Earlham will be announced during the evening festivities at the park, with the drawing of the raffle prizes to follow.
Raffle prizes are being collected now, and include gift certificates, sporting event tickets, prize packages and much more. Any donations to the raffle can be mailed to P.O. Box 463 in Earlham.
